This article introduces a distributed model of trust for app developers in
Android and iOS mobile ecosystems. The model aims to allow the co-existence of
multiple app stores and distribution channels while retaining a high level of
safety for mobile device users and minimum changes to current mobile operating
systems. The Developers Certification Model (DCM) is a trust model for Android
and iOS that aims to distinguish legit applications from security threats to
